Suppose there is a hole is a copper plate. Upon heating the plate, diameter of hole, would :

none of these

always increase

always decrease

always remain the same

When a copper plate with a hole is heated, it expands uniformly in all directions due to thermal expansion. The hole behaves as if it were made of copper itself. The diameter of the hole is a linear dimension, and it increases with temperature, just like the outer dimensions of the plate. The change in diameter (ΔD) is given by ΔD = D₀ * α * ΔT, where D₀ is the original diameter, α is the coefficient of linear expansion, and ΔT is the temperature change.

Therefore, the diameter of the hole will always increase.

Final Answer: always increase
